Michael Soileau

VP - Competitive Planning & Strategy | Comcast Cable

Michael Soileau brings more than 18 years in cable and telecommunications to his position as Vice President of Competitive Planning and Strategy for Comcast Cable. In this role, he is responsible for the planning and design of initiatives using Comcast technology to deliver innovative solutions in Comcast markets. He is also responsible for understanding the company’s competitive pressures and developing and deploying strategic plans to navigate this landscape. Michael also manages the research and articulation of industry developments and needs from new and emerging providers and future products that have yet to be publically available.

Previously, Michael worked for FTI Consulting as the Senior Vice President of Sales, Marketing and Customer Experience for Innovative Communications, a $110 million multi service provider (MSP) of phone, data, video and wireless for the United States Virgin Islands, British Virgin Islands and St. Maarten.
